Document Description
150-LOT TENTATIVE SUBDIVISION ON 232 ACRES. REZONE TO "PD", PLANNED DEVELOPMENT CONSISTING OF 144 RESIDENTIAL LOTS, TWO LOTS FOR HIGHWAY COMMERCIAL, TWO LOTS FOR MULTIPLE-FAMILY RESIDENTIAL, ONE PARCEL FOR FUTURE DEVELOPMENT, AND ONE PARCEL FOR COMMUNITY COLLECTION TREATMENT SEWAGE DISPOSAL AREA. WATER TO BE SUPPLIED BY COMMUNITY SYSTEM. PROJECT LOCATED ON BOTH SIDES OF HWY. 88 SOUTH OF PINE GROVE IN AMADOR CO.
